Step-by-Step Guide to Choosing the Perfect Bold Hair Crown

Let’s break down how to pick the crown that screams “future queen.”

Step 1: Match Your Face Shape

Different face shapes suit specific styles:

  • Oval faces = Can pull off anything. Go wild!
  • Round faces = Opt for tall designs to elongate.
  • Heart-shaped faces = Look for wide bases to balance proportions.

Step 2: Consider Color Coordination

Your crown should harmonize with your outfit OR make a deliberate contrast. Think gold tones against pastels or dark florals over neutrals.

Step 3: Prioritize Comfort

This ain’t Game of Thrones—you don’t need blisters from poorly padded crowns. Test weight and adjustability before finalizing your purchase.

5 Tips for Styling Bold Hair Crowns Like a Pro

  1. Tease That Volume: Start by backcombing roots near the crown area. No one wants their regal accessory slipping mid-dance floor.
  2. Secure Placement: Bobby pins AREN’T optional. Crisscross the pins beneath the crown base for extra hold.
  3. Spritz Some Hairspray: This not only keeps your ‘do intact but also ensures the crown stays put.
  4. Tone Down Other Accessories: Avoid clashing glam vibes. Let the crown shine solo.
  5. Don’t Forget Confidence: Honestly, strutting like royalty is half the battle. Own it.

FAQs About Bold Hair Crowns

Q: Are bold hair crowns suitable for short hairstyles?
Absolutely! Simply secure the crown closer to the nape using additional bobby pins or clips.

Q: How do I avoid looking like a kid playing dress-up?
Focus on clean lines and polished finishes. Sleek braids or smooth waves paired with a statement crown elevate the overall aesthetic.
